Problem description: 
crash just after start , i use /opt/libreoffice3.6/program/oosplash to run libreoffice, but when i just see the splash screen, libreoffice crash, without any error message, i use $? to get the error code: "139".
i try version 3.6.1.1, it was the same.
the version 3.5.6.4 worked fine.
i have attach the file created by "strace -f /opt/libreoffice3.6/program/soffice.bin > /tmp/strace.log 2>&1"

Comment 5 Stephan Bergmann 2012-08-22 09:41:03 UTC
(In reply to comment #0)
> i use /opt/libreoffice3.6/program/oosplash to run libreoffice

This is not as intended.  Please always run soffice instead of oosplash.

Anyway, the problem here is /home/walkerxk/.fonts/Aquabase-spanish-support.ttf, which is a known (and fixed) problem.
